What Key Features Define the Best Carry On Luggage?

The best carry-on luggage is defined by key features that enhance convenience and functionality for travelers.

  1. Size and Dimensions
  2. Durability
  3. Weight
  4. Compartments and Organization
  5. Mobility
  6. Design and Style
  7. Security Features
  8. Warranty and Customer Support

The combination of these features can vary based on traveler preferences and specific travel needs.

  1. Size and Dimensions:
    Size and dimensions of carry-on luggage refer to the allowable measurements set by airlines. The International Air Transport Association (IATA) suggests that the maximum dimensions for carry-on bags typically should not exceed 22 x 14 x 9 inches (56 x 36 x 23 cm). Travelers should verify their airline’s specific requirements as they can vary. For example, budget airlines often enforce stricter limits on size. Choosing a size that maximizes packing space while complying with airline regulations is crucial.

  2. Durability:
    Durability in carry-on luggage refers to the material and construction quality that withstands wear and tear. Common materials include polycarbonate, ballistic nylon, and aluminum. A study by Luggage Pros indicates that hard-shell luggage offers better impact resistance than soft-shell luggage. Additionally, reinforced seams and strong zippers are vital for long-lasting durability. Higher durability results in fewer replacements, ultimately saving money over time.

  3. Weight:
    Weight indicates how heavy the carry-on luggage is when empty. Lighter luggage allows travelers to maximize packing without exceeding weight limits. According to Travel + Leisure, the ideal carry-on weighs less than 7 pounds (3.2 kg) when empty. Heavy luggage can complicate travel and lead to extra fees. Lightweight materials such as polypropylene or lightweight aluminum can enhance portability.

  4. Compartments and Organization:
    Compartments and organization refer to the internal and external sections of the luggage that offer storage solutions. Multiple compartments help separate items, which is essential for efficient packing. For example, a dedicated shoe compartment keeps dirty shoes away from clothing. Reviews from Wirecutter show that organized luggage can reduce stress during travel. Mesh pockets, tie-down straps, and external zippers all contribute to better organization.

  5. Mobility:
    Mobility describes how easily a suitcase can be maneuvered. Features affecting mobility include wheels, handles, and weight distribution. Spinner wheels that rotate 360 degrees are popular for effortless movement, as noted by the Backpacker magazine. Trolley handles should be adjustable to accommodate users of different heights. A well-designed bag can significantly enhance the travel experience, especially in crowded airports.

  6. Design and Style:
    Design and style encompass the visual appeal and aesthetic of the luggage. Not only should carry-on luggage be functional, but it should also reflect the user’s personality. Traveler preferences may include classic colors, bold patterns, or sleek designs. Fashion experts from Vogue emphasize that style can impact the perception of the traveler, making first impressions important.

  7. Security Features:
    Security features enhance the safety of belongings. Common features include built-in locks, TSA-approved locks, and anti-theft zippers. The Transportation Security Administration (TSA) recommends locks that can be opened by TSA agents, preventing damage during security checks. Some luggage also incorporates RFID-blocking technology to protect against electronic theft. Consumers are advised to consider security features based on their travel destinations.

  8. Warranty and Customer Support:
    Warranty and customer support refer to the guarantees provided by manufacturers regarding their products. A good warranty can offer peace of mind, especially for higher-priced luggage. Companies like Samsonite often provide limited lifetime warranties, indicating confidence in their products. Customer support accessibility is essential for addressing any issues that may arise after purchase. Positive customer service experiences can influence repeated purchases and brand loyalty.

Which Materials Are Essential for Durability in Carry On Luggage?

The essential materials for durability in carry-on luggage include lightweight and sturdy options that withstand wear and tear.

  1. Polycarbonate
  2. ABS Plastic
  3. Nylon
  4. Leather
  5. Aluminum
  6. EVA Foam

The selection of materials varies significantly depending on preferences for weight, aesthetics, and budget constraints.

  1. Polycarbonate: Polycarbonate is a durable plastic known for its light weight and high impact resistance. It can protect belongings during travel and resist scratches. Many travelers appreciate its ability to flex under pressure, reducing the risk of cracks compared to other materials. A study by the International Journal of Material Science (2021) highlighted that polycarbonate luggage can withstand extreme stress without breaking.

  2. ABS Plastic: ABS plastic is another popular material. It is affordable and provides reasonable durability against low-impact damage. However, its toughness is not on par with polycarbonate. Some customers favor ABS luggage for its cost-effectiveness, especially for occasional travelers. A consumer report from 2022 indicated that while ABS luggage often shows more wear over time, it remains a suitable option for short trips.

  3. Nylon: Nylon is a fabric often used in soft-sided luggage. It is lightweight and offers good resistance to tearing and abrasion. Nylon’s waterproof variants provide added protection against the elements. Many choose nylon for its flexibility in packing and storage. A market analysis in 2020 suggested that soft-sided nylon bags have gained popularity due to their expandable features, catering to varied packing needs.

  4. Leather: Leather luggage is highly durable and offers a classy appearance. Genuine leather is known for its strength and aging well over time. However, care is required to maintain its look. While high-maintenance, leather luggage is often seen as a status symbol. According to fashion designers, leather carry-ons can last decades with proper care, making them a worthwhile investment.

  5. Aluminum: Aluminum carry-on luggage is renowned for its toughness and security features. It is often equipped with advanced locking mechanisms and creates a hard shell protecting contents from impacts. Aluminum luggage is heavier but offers unbeatable durability. A well-known travel brand states that aluminum luggage appeals to frequent travelers who prioritize protection over weight.

  6. EVA Foam: EVA foam is used in lightweight luggage for padding and protection. It helps absorb shock and reduce damage to fragile items. This material is both durable and lightweight, making it a good choice for interior compartments. Recent studies suggest that EVA foam’s resilience makes it valuable in ensuring the safety of electronic devices packed inside luggage.

How Can You Select the Optimal Size for Your Carry On Luggage Based on Your Needs?

To select the optimal size for your carry-on luggage, consider airline restrictions, your travel duration, and personal packing habits.

Airline restrictions: Different airlines have varying size limits for carry-on luggage. Most domestic airlines in the U.S. allow a carry-on bag that measures no more than 22 x 14 x 9 inches, including wheels and handles. The International Air Transport Association (IATA) recommends a maximum size of 55 x 40 x 20 cm (approximately 21.5 x 15.5 x 7.5 inches) for international flights. Always check your airline’s website for specific measurements to avoid additional charges.

Travel duration: Your travel length significantly influences your luggage size. For short trips (1–3 days), a smaller carry-on that accommodates essential items, such as clothes, toiletries, and electronics, usually suffices. For longer trips (4 days or more), consider a larger carry-on or a bag with expandable features, providing extra space for additional clothing and personal items.

Packing habits: Evaluate how you pack to determine the size suitable for you. If you prefer to bring multiple changes of clothes, shoes, and accessories, a larger bag may be essential. Those who pack light may find a smaller carry-on sufficient. The average traveler carries about 3 outfits, so consider how many you realistically need based on your itinerary.

Personal preferences: Comfort is also crucial in selecting carry-on luggage. A bag that is too bulky can be cumbersome to maneuver through airports. Ensure the bag fits easily in the overhead compartment or under the seat in front of you. Look for lightweight materials and easy-rolling wheels, which can ease transportation.

In summary, selecting the optimal size for your carry-on luggage involves understanding airline restrictions, matching the bag’s capacity with your travel duration, assessing your packing habits, and prioritizing personal comfort.

What Are the Top Brands Known for Quality Carry On Luggage?

The top brands known for quality carry-on luggage include Samsonite, Away, Rimowa, Travelpro, and Tumi.

  1. Samsonite
  2. Away
  3. Rimowa
  4. Travelpro
  5. Tumi

Many travelers have varying opinions on these brands. For example, some prefer the durability of Rimowa, while others value the affordability of Samsonite. Additionally, certain consumers appreciate the sleek design and innovation features found in Away luggage, whereas frequent business travelers often gravitate towards Travelpro for practicality.

  1. Samsonite:
    Samsonite produces carry-on luggage known for its durability and variety. Founded in 1910, the brand offers a wide range of options for different travel needs. Samsonite luggage often features robust materials, such as polycarbonate and nylon. According to reviews, customers appreciate its balance of quality and price.

  2. Away:
    Away specializes in stylish and functional carry-on luggage. Established in 2015, it quickly gained popularity due to its modern design and useful features, like built-in USB chargers. Customers report satisfaction with the lifetime warranty and exceptional customer service. Away’s customization options also attract younger travelers.

  3. Rimowa:
    Rimowa is renowned for its premium hard-shell luggage. The brand, founded in 1898, uses aluminum and polycarbonate, providing exceptional durability. Many travelers choose Rimowa for its classic design and status symbol. Rimowa’s emphasis on craftsmanship is evident in its attention to detail and innovative features.

  4. Travelpro:
    Travelpro is a favorite among airline crew and frequent travelers. Founded by a commercial pilot in 1987, the brand focuses on practicality and durability. Travelpro carry-on luggage often includes features such as self-repairing zippers and lightweight designs. Its reputation for quality ensures it remains a go-to choice for regular travelers.

  5. Tumi:
    Tumi offers high-end luggage known for business travel. Established in 1975, Tumi focuses on both functionality and aesthetics. The luggage often includes organizational features and premium materials. Tumi is frequently associated with luxury travel, attracting consumers willing to invest in long-lasting products. Many businesses endorse Tumi for its reputation and quality assurance.
